Focused on the world of reality television and pop culture, the discussions often center around the Real Housewives franchise and other notable figures in television. The hosts engage in lively banter, providing commentary that is both humorous and relatable while critiquing the dynamics of various shows and their characters. Unique insights into personal experiences, including anecdotes about mental health and social issues, add depth to the conversations, making them both entertaining and thought-provoking. It's a space where laughter meets candid dialogue about contemporary celebrity culture and its intersection with personal narratives.
